2. A Mountain Quiltfest

If you’re a fan of quilting or just like to admire the artwork, the annual Mountain Quiltfest is one of the great spring events in Pigeon Forge you’ll want to see. This is a 5-day event is held at the beginning of March and features quilting accessories, classes, and of course, a large selection of quilts all for your viewing pleasure. There’s a chance you might find your very own creative streak after browsing through this event!

3. Spring Rod Run

One of the biggest car shows in the Smoky Mountains every year is the ​Spring Rod Run​. Car enthusiasts near and far flock to the area to see hundreds of classics that you don’t normally come across on a daily basis anymore. The LeConte Center is the venue for this popular event. There will be plenty of vendors onsite selling everything from T-shirts to tasty treats that will give you a nice break after walking every single square foot of space filled with shiny metal!

5. Chuck Wagon Cookoff

Clabough’s Campground is the setting for the ​Chuck Wagon Cookoff​ held during the beginning of April. This is a unique and fun event that features chuck wagon cook teams competing for the best prepared meals. In addition to getting some outstanding grub, there’s a wide variety of fun activities for kids and adults.
